

Obama will cut the deficit in half in 4 years
Treasury Secretary Timothy Geithner on Sunday said revenue generated by a moderate economic recovery and ending the stimulus bill will halve the deficit in 4 years.
"Those two actions, themselves, will cut our deficit in half as a share of the economy, bringing it down from 10 percent as a share of GDP to around 5 percent of GDP," he said on NBC's Meet the Press. He added, "This is something we can manage as a country."
"He [Obama] has outlined a very hard, ambitious set of proposals that will cut our deficit by more than half as a share of the economy in the next 4 years," he said.
